# Full Stack Angular and Dot Net Developer

**Company:** [Eastencher Software pvt lmt](http://jobs.workable.com/companies/1rigXfMdkbCxapSaSshmFD.md)
**Location:** Bengaluru, India
**Workplace:** on site
**Employment type:** Full-time
**Department:** IT

[Apply for this job](http://jobs.workable.com/view/b3dc07f4-77d4-4221-a5b5-5e21617939bd)

## Description

**Job Title**: Full Stack Developer (3-5 Years Experience)

**Location**: Bangalore

**Experience**: 3–5 Years

**Open Positions**: 10

**Company**: Eastencher Software Pvt. Ltd.

Eastencher Software Pvt Ltd is seeking a skilled and motivated Full Stack Developer to join our dynamic and innovative team. As a Full Stack Developer, you will play a crucial role in designing, developing, and maintaining end-to-end web applications that drive our business forward. This position requires someone with a strong technical background, a keen eye for detail, and the ability to work collaboratively in a fast-paced environment. You will be responsible for both front-end and back-end development, ensuring seamless integration and excellent user experiences. At Eastencher Software Pvt Ltd, we value creativity, problem-solving, and continuous learning, providing you with an exciting opportunity to enhance your skills and grow professionally. If you are passionate about technology, eager to work on cutting-edge projects, and ready to contribute to a forward-thinking company, we would love to hear from you. Join us and be part of a talented team dedicated to delivering high-quality software solutions that make a difference in the industry.

### Responsibilities

-   **Design, develop, and maintain** robust web applications utilizing **Angular** for the front-end and **.NET Core / ASP.NET** for the back-end ecosystem.
-   **Collaborate with cross-functional teams** to define, design, and ship new features, ensuring seamless integration between Angular components and **RESTful .NET Web APIs**.
-   **Write clean, scalable, and efficient code** following industry best practices, implementing structured **TypeScript** architectures on the front-end and solid **C# OOP principles** on the back-end.
-   **Perform code reviews** and provide constructive feedback to team members, ensuring adherence to coding standards like enterprise .NET patterns and Angular style guides.
-   **Troubleshoot, debug, and resolve** complex technical issues, utilizing debugging tools across both browser dev tools and the .NET ecosystem.
-   **Optimize applications** for maximum speed, responsiveness, and scalability, focusing on Angular lazy loading/state management and efficient database queries via **Entity Framework**.
-   **Stay up-to-date with emerging technologies** and updates within the Microsoft and Angular roadmaps to continuously modernize project architectures.

## Requirements

-   **roven experience** as a Full Stack Developer or similar role, with a strong, dedicated focus on the **.NET and Angular** is must.
-   **Mandatory proficiency in Angular** (v2+) and core front-end technologies, including **TypeScript**, HTML5, CSS3, and modern JavaScript.
-   **Hands-on backend experience** explicitly using **C# and .NET Core / ASP.NET** (rather than alternative stacks like Node.js, Python, or Java).
-   **Strong familiarity with database systems**, specifically **SQL Server (T-SQL)** or similar relational databases, alongside **Entity Framework Core**.
-   **Deep understanding of RESTful APIs**, including building secured, scalable Web APIs in .NET and integrating them with third-party services.
-   **Solid knowledge of version control systems**, explicitly **Git**, and familiarity with CI/CD deployment pipelines.
-   **Excellent problem-solving skills** and the ability to work independently or collaborate effectively within an agile team environment.

**Soft Skills**

-   Strong analytical and problem-solving skills
-   Good communication and collaboration abilities
-   Ability to work independently and meet deadlines.

**Work Mode**

-   Full-Time
-   Work From Office (Bangalore)

**Interview Rounds:**

Round 1: **Technical Round (In-office face to face).**

Round 2: Technical Round (Virtual).

Round 2: Managerial Round (Virtual).

Round 3: HR Round (Virtual).
